Vision Eye Art
901 E. Center St.
414-263-1312
414-263-1319 (fax)
visioneyeart@sbcglobal.net
Hours: Mo – Fr: 10 am – 7 pm
Sa: 10 am – 2 pm
Su: Closed
Proprietor: Luke Lopez, ABO Certified Optician
When there’s great art hanging on the wall, what good
is it if you can’t see it? Opened last October, Vision
Eye Art is a combination optical store and art gallery.
Proprietor Luke Lopez offers his walls to local artists and
even features some of his own pieces. If it’s frames you’re
after, he features top brands like Calvin Klein, Gabbana
and Versace. He also offers the services of a doctor who
comes in two days per week to provide eye exams
(Mondays and Saturdays, appointment only). You can
usually get your glasses the same day, otherwise, no
more than 10 business days. – Jim Lowe

Glass Aquatics
820 E Locust St
Hours: Mo – Th: 2 – 8 pm
Sa – Su: 12 – 5 pm
263.1978
glassaquatics@hotmail.com
While living in the UWM dorms, Ryan Glass cleaned the
fish tanks of basketball players in exchange for meal
cards. Today Ryan has 10 years experience providing
professional maintenance and runs Glass Aquatics,
which may be the only place you can get live coral reef
in Riverwest. Glass Aquatics specializes in saltwater
fish. Ryan can special-order any fish, which arrive
twice a week. Looking for an eel with zebra stripes or
clown triggerfish? Look no further. Custom tanks and
instillation are available. In case you’re wondering, the
Zenith console tank in the windowisn’t for sale. Glass
Aquatics also sells pet food and accessories. Coming
soon: live crickets. – Ben Elmadari
Smash Wireless
906 E. Center St.
414-372-4555
414-758-1524 (cell)
sales@smashwireless.com
www.smashwireless.com
Winter Hours: Mo – Fr: 11 am – 6 pm,
Sa – Su: 12 pm – 5 pm
(Summer hours likely to be expanded)
Proprietors: Elmer Coleman, Darryl Coleman, Lee
Coleman
No busy signal here. Smash Wireless is a new addition
to Riverwest, opening this past December. Specializing
in prepaid cellular phones such as Verizon, Sprint,
Cingular and Locus, they offer packages starting as low
as just 4 cents per minute. Come spring, they would
like to create a lounge area complete with a Playstation
2 with hopes of starting league play. In addition,
they’re thinking of setting up some computers and
offering free Wi-Fi. They came to Riverwest because
it’s convenient and safe for their customers. But they’re
also hoping to fill a need and provide service for our
community. – Jim Lowe
